What climate can residents expect in George Town?

George Town enjoys a mild, Mediterranean‑influenced oceanic climate with warm summers (average max ≈ 21 °C) and cool, wetter winters (average max ≈ 13 °C). Annual rainfall averages about 672 mm spread over roughly 133 days.

What community facilities are available in George Town?

The town is well served with a regional hospital, supermarkets and a range of clubs such as the George Town Football Club, Bowls Club and Cricket Club, as well as cultural venues like the Bass and Flinders Maritime Museum.

Are there any historic or natural attractions near 33 Lawrence Street?

Yes – attractions within a few kilometres include the Low Head lighthouse and pilot station, the historic ‘Grove’ Georgian home, and the Little Penguin colony at Low Head beach. The Paterson Memorial heritage place is also about 1.8 km away.

What outdoor recreation options are nearby?

George Town offers seaside activities such as swimming, surfing, fishing and boating, and the council is developing 80 km of mountain‑bike trails on Mount George and the Tippogoree Hills, both a short drive from the property.
